ARTS 30A - Mixed Media I3 units • LG-P/NP • Total hours: 102 hours studio
This course is an exploration of mixed media techniques, which may include combinations of painting, drawing, collage, printmaking, and/or photography. A variety of methods and materials are used. Emphases are on technical proficiency, conceptualization, and individual expression. Portions of instruction may be offered online; may also be offered fully online.
Advisories: ARTB 2 (or ART 22); or ARTB 4 (or ART 24); completion of or concurrent enrollment in ENGL 1A
Credit transferable: CSU

ARTS 40A - Painting I
3 units • LG-P/NP • Total hours: 17 hours lecture; 76.5 hours studio
Introduction to principles, elements, and practices of painting. Focus on exploration of painting materials, perceptual skills and color theory, paint mixing and technique, as well as creative responses to materials and subject matter. Portions of instruction may be offered online; may also be offered fully online. [C-ID ARTS 210]
Advisories: ARTB 2 (or ART 22); or ARTB 4 (or ART 24); and ARTS 10A (or ART 28A)
Credit transferable: CSU, UC
GE Credit: MPC, Area C, E2

ARTS 41A - Watercolor I
3 units • LG-P/NP • Total hours: 102 hours studio
This course offers an introduction to watercolor painting with emphasis on transparent washes and experimental methods. Portions of instruction may be offered online; may also be offered fully online.
Advisories: ARTB 2 (or ART 22); or ARTB 4 (or ART 24)
Credit transferable: CSU, UC
GE Credit: MPC, Area E2
